In this episode, we are joined by William Jeynes, a Professor of Education at California State University, Long Beach who has graduate degrees from both Harvard University and the University of Chicago.
Having written for both the George W. Bush and Obama administrations, Professor Jeynes is no stranger to the nature of education and politics. He sits down with us today to discuss his work and the economic intricacies of the United States…
